The GBP/USD currency pair has shown signs of bullish momentum, breaking above the 1.3555 level and closing near 1.3532, according to FX Street. This movement invalidated a recent neutral outlook and suggests an intraday extension toward 1.3570, with a key resistance level identified at 1.3600.
Market analyst Quek Ser Leang from United Overseas Bank noted the British Pound's strength against the US Dollar, highlighting the potential for further upside if the pair can sustain its current levels. The break above 1.3555 marks a shift in market sentiment, indicating an emerging uptrend.
